What is Water Leak Detection, and Why is it Important in Idaho Falls?

Water leak detection is the process of identifying and locating hidden water leaks in your home or business. In the Idaho Falls area, water le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including aging pipes, faulty appliances, and seasonal weather patterns. Water leaks can lead to significant damage to your property, including structural damage, mold growth, and electrical hazards. Water Leak Detection Cost in the 83241 Area

The cost of water leak detection and repair services can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and other local factors in the 83241 area. We’ll provide you with a detailed estimate of the work to be done, including a breakdown of the costs and services involved. Our prices are competitive, and we’ll work to ensure that you get the best value for your money.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the amount of water involved, and the complexity of the issue
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of water involved, and the complexity of the issue
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of water involved, and the complexity of the issue
Sewage Cleanup $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of water involved, and the complexity of the issue
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of water involved, and the complexity of the issue

Common Questions About Water Leak Detection in the 83241 Area

How do I know if I have a water leak?

Look for signs of a water leak, such as a musty smell, water stains on the ceiling or walls, and increased water bills. If you suspect a water leak, turn off the main water valve and call a professional to diagnose and repair the issue.
